UV finiteness of 3D Yang-Mills theories with a regulating mass in the Landau gauge

D. Dudal, J. A. Gracey, R. F. Sobreiro, S. P. Sorella, and H. Verschelde
Phys. Rev. D 75, 061701(R) – Published 14 March 2007

Abstract

We prove that three-dimensional Yang-Mills theories in the Landau gauge supplemented with a infrared regulating, parity preserving mass term are ultraviolet finite to all orders. We also extend this result to the Curci-Ferrari gauge.
